Understanding Exhibition Insurance Cover: A Comprehensive Guide

Exhibiting at trade shows, fairs, and other events can be a great way to showcase products and services, generate leads, and connect with potential clients. However, there are risks involved in participating in exhibitions that can potentially impact your business, such as theft, damage to your display, or even injuries to visitors at your booth. This is where exhibition insurance cover comes into play.

Exhibition insurance cover is a type of insurance policy specifically designed to protect exhibitors from financial losses and liabilities that may occur during an event. Whether you are attending a local trade show or a large-scale international exhibition, having the right insurance coverage in place can give you peace of mind and protect your investment.

What Does exhibition insurance cover?

Exhibition insurance cover typically includes the following types of coverage:

1. Property Coverage: This type of coverage protects your exhibit materials, displays, products, and equipment from risks such as theft, damage, vandalism, or fire. If any of your property is lost or damaged during the exhibition, your insurance policy will cover the cost of repairs or replacement.

2. Liability Coverage: Liability insurance is essential for exhibitors, as it protects you from potential lawsuits and claims that may arise from injuries to visitors at your booth, damage to third-party property, or other accidents that occur during the event. Liability coverage can help pay for legal fees, settlements, and medical expenses in the event of a claim.

3. Event Cancellation Coverage: If the exhibition is canceled or postponed due to unforeseen circumstances such as extreme weather, natural disasters, or public health emergencies, event cancellation insurance can reimburse you for any non-refundable expenses you have incurred, such as booth fees, travel costs, or accommodation.

4. Business Interruption Coverage: In the event that your business operations are disrupted due to a covered loss at the exhibition, such as a fire at your booth or damage to your inventory, business interruption insurance can help compensate you for lost income and ongoing expenses until you are able to resume normal operations.

5. Cyber Insurance: With the rise of digital technology and online transactions, cyber insurance has become increasingly important for exhibitors who collect and store sensitive data from customers. Cyber insurance can protect you from data breaches, cyber attacks, and other online risks that could jeopardize your business reputation and financial security.

Why Do You Need exhibition insurance cover?

Participating in exhibitions can be a significant financial investment for your business, from booth fees and display materials to promotional materials and travel expenses. Without adequate insurance coverage, you could be exposing your business to serious financial risks that could potentially result in significant losses or even bankruptcy.

Exhibition insurance cover provides exhibitors with the protection they need to safeguard their assets, mitigate risks, and focus on showcasing their products and services without worrying about the unexpected. In the event of a loss, having insurance in place can help you recover quickly and avoid costly out-of-pocket expenses that could threaten your bottom line.

Selecting the Right Insurance Policy

When choosing an exhibition insurance policy, it is important to carefully review the coverage options, limits, exclusions, and premiums to ensure that you are adequately protected. Consider the specific risks associated with the event, the value of your exhibit materials, and the potential liabilities you may face as an exhibitor.

It is also a good idea to work with an experienced insurance agent or broker who specializes in exhibition insurance to help you navigate the complexities of the policy and ensure that you have the right coverage for your needs. They can help you assess your risks, evaluate your assets, and tailor a policy that provides comprehensive protection at a competitive price.
